java中类和对象的知识点总结

 更新时间:2020年12月29日 08:41:49   作者:小妮浅浅  
在本篇文章里小编给大家整理了一篇关于java中类和对象的知识点总结,有需要的朋友们可以学习下。

虽然说最近带着小伙伴们学了不少java中的知识点,但是对于最基本的概念,是每个小伙伴必不可少学习的要点。我们需要时时对它们进行复习和考察,才不会在后期结合其他的知识点而不会使用,下面小编就为大家带来java中类和对象的讲解,一起往下看看吧。

1.类和对象

类是一类对象的统称。

对象是这个类具体的一个实例。

基本语法为:

 class 类名{
 //属性
 //方法
}
//例
class person{
 public int age;
 public String name;
 public String sex;
 public void sleep(){
 System.out.println("睡觉");
 }
}

2.类的实例化

class person{
 public int age;
 public String name;
 public String sex;
 public void sleep(){
 System.out.println("睡觉");
 }
public class Main{
public static void main(String[] args){
 person p = new person();//通过new关键字实例化对象
 p.sleep();//调用成员方法
 //一个类可以创建多个实例化对象
 person p2 = new person();
 person p3 = new person();
}
}

注意:

new关键字用来创建一个对象的实例

使用.来访问对象中的属性和方法

同一个类可以创建多个实例对象

3.类的成员:

字段/属性/成员变量:在类中,但是定义在方法外部的变量

 class person{
 public int age;//字段
 public String name;
 public String sex;
 public void sleep(){
 System.out.println("睡觉");
 }
}

方法:用于描述一个对象的行为。

class person{
 public int age;//字段
 public String name;
 public String sex;
 //方法
 public void sleep(){
 System.out.println("睡觉");
 }
}

到此这篇关于java中类和对象的知识点总结的文章就介绍到这了,更多相关java中类和对象的详解内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家!

相关文章

  • 浅析JPA分类表的操作函数

    浅析JPA分类表的操作函数

    这篇文章主要介绍了JPA分类表的操作函数,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习吧
    2023-02-02
  • Exception in thread main java.lang.NoClassDefFoundError错误解决方法

    Exception in thread main java.lang.NoClassDefFoundError错误解决方

    这篇文章主要介绍了Exception in thread main java.lang.NoClassDefFoundError错误解决方法,需要的朋友可以参考下
    2016-08-08
  • 一文详解Spring 中的顺序问题

    一文详解Spring 中的顺序问题

    本文主要介绍了Spring 中的顺序问题,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2023-05-05
  • Java设计模式之依赖倒转原则精解

    Java设计模式之依赖倒转原则精解

    设计模式(Design pattern)代表了最佳的实践,通常被有经验的面向对象的软件开发人员所采用。设计模式是软件开发人员在软件开发过程中面临的一般问题的解决方案。本篇介绍设计模式七大原则之一的依赖倒转原则
    2022-02-02
  • Java三目运算符的实战案例

    Java三目运算符的实战案例

    三目运算符在java中运用可以说非常的广泛,下面这篇文章主要给大家介绍了关于Java三目运算符的相关资料,文中通过实例代码介绍的非常详细,需要的朋友可以参考下
    2022-09-09
  • java如何动态的处理接口的返回数据

    java如何动态的处理接口的返回数据

    本文主要介绍了java如何动态的处理接口的返回数据,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2023-01-01
  • mybatis-flex与springBoot整合的实现示例

    mybatis-flex与springBoot整合的实现示例

    Mybatis-flex提供了简单易用的API,开发者只需要简单的配置即可使用,本文主要介绍了mybatis-flex与springBoot整合,具有一定的参考价值,感兴趣的可以了解一下
    2024-01-01
  • spring boot权限管理的几种常见方式

    spring boot权限管理的几种常见方式

    这篇文章主要给大家介绍了关于spring boot权限管理的几种常见方式,在Web应用程序中,用户权限管理是至关重要的,文中通过代码示例介绍的非常详细,需要的朋友可以参考下
    2023-08-08
  • Java并发编程之ReentrantLock解析

    Java并发编程之ReentrantLock解析

    这篇文章主要介绍了Java并发编程之ReentrantLock解析,ReentrantLock内容定义了一个抽象类Sync,继承自AQS,而不是自己去继承AQS,所有对ReentrantLock的操作都会转化为对Sync的操作,需要的朋友可以参考下
    2023-12-12
  • 一文带你彻底搞懂Lambda表达式

    一文带你彻底搞懂Lambda表达式

    这篇文章主要介绍了一文带你彻底搞懂Lambda表达式,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2020-09-09

最新评论